1、公交/地铁出行的场景,需要考虑哪些测试点,请根据给出的示意图和用户平时的使用场景进行用例设计
回答:
定位—我的初始位置是否准确 路线结束时是否能准确到达目的地 如有偏差 差距多少 行走过程中是否实时显示个人定位
导航路线是否最近优先,公交如果堵车是否有可切换路线 公交换乘是否准确,实时公交是否准时 地铁换乘路线是否
清晰 步行导航时是否显示小路优先 地铁/公交维修时是否提示,并给出解决最佳方案 地铁/公交的满载率 上车后前进
站点是否以此减少并在试图中显示 从出发到结束预估时间与实际用时是否相符,如有偏差,差距多少 终点站是否提前
提示用户车 当用户坐过站后是否可以重新计算路线 点击步行导航是否打开地图 出行路线过长时是否可以隐藏线路
点击隐藏时是否展示全部路线 跨区时是否可显示地区名 公交/地铁的首末班车
功能测试:
1.全部领完之后天数是否清零
2.立即签到按钮多次点击
3.中途断开,是否可以补签
4.每天签到时,天数是否增加
5.时间为凌晨23点59分59秒,一秒钟后重登游戏,今日签到是否刷新领取
6.注意:无论是道具、货币奖励,都要进行前后端验证。如何验证?最简单的方法就是重新登录。重登后,道具还在,说明前后端都已经发放了。
7…今日内再次登陆游戏,看看是否可以再次签到
8.今日已登陆,第二天登陆,查看情况,是否可以再次领取
性能测试:
1.响应时间,点击签到多久可以响应成功
2.点击签到,如果签到失败会不会弹框显示
易用性测试:
1.页面布局,是否有错别字,符合用户的使用
兼容性测试:
1.手机,,,浏览器
弱网测试:
1.2G/3G/4G/5G
3.如果项目上线在上线期间出现问题改怎么办?
1.首先要做的是重现这个问题并反馈给研发人员,尽快出patch或者解决方案。
2.当BUG解决且上线没有问题之后,我们再看后续的处理。
追查原因及处理方法:这个BUG出现的原因是什么。
2测试上线后出现问题分为几种情况:
1)测试环境无法重现:可能是线上的环境造成的BUG或者是测试环境无法模拟的情况.
解决方法:尽量完善测试方法、尽量模拟测试环境、增加线上测试。
2)漏测:
1.测试用例裁剪过度:错误预估优先级或者时间过于紧迫裁剪了用例
解决方法:在后续版本或者其他项目启动时重新评估测试时间,要求专家介入对优先级进行评估,避免此类事件再次发生。
2.测试用例执行期间遗漏:由于测试人员疏忽造成测试用例执行遗漏。
解决方法:调查该名测试人员的整个测试过程的工作情况,并随机抽测其他模块,
对该名测试人员进行综合评估,给出结论,是因为偷懒漏测,还是因为负责模块过多漏测,还是有其他原因,
对该名测试人员发出警告,对相关测试主管,项目经理,产品经理发出警告。
3.测试用例覆盖不全:由于用例评审的不严格造成的;中途需求变更造成的;由于某些其他因素造成的。
解决方法:找到原因,并进行记录,在以后的项目或者下一版本重点关注。
4.linux上安装jdk。Mysql。Tomact
5.写博客:博客内容(设计点:三个题)、安装步骤。